Indivisible 605 is joining this May Day Strong coalition. While we’ve asked our members to strike on May 1st, the damage from this Administration’s policies continues to negatively impact our neighbors. “Our unhoused population in Sioux Falls exceeds 2000 people and they are in need of shoes and personal hygiene products. Our city simply tickets them for being unhoused and hasn’t found a solution to move citizens from unsheltered to sheltered to stable housing”, explained Roni Wegner, Advisory Board Chair of Indivisible 605. She added “every human being deserves dignity and a helping hand when needed”. Donations of gently used and new shoes plus new personal hygiene items can be dropped off from 4/20/26 through 5/2/26 at Remedy Brewing or The Painted Lady Tattoo. On Saturday, May 2nd, Indivisible 605 members will be at Remedy Brewing from 3-5pm to meet and greet the public and thank them for their donations.
